Rob Halford: A Life in Metal

Robert John Arthur Halford, widely known as the "Metal God," has left an undeniable mark on music history. His powerful voice and unique style helped define the sound of heavy metal. He was, in some respects, a true pioneer in the genre. His career spans decades, filled with iconic performances and influential albums that continue to inspire musicians and fans around the globe. It's quite something, really, to have such a lasting impact.

Personal Details and Bio Data

Full NameRobert John Arthur Halford
BornAugust 25, 1951
BirthplaceSutton Coldfield, West Midlands, England
Known ForLead vocalist of Judas Priest
NicknameThe Metal God
GenresHeavy Metal, Hard Rock

The Rise of Judas Priest

Joining Judas Priest in 1973 was a pivotal moment for Halford and for heavy metal itself. His arrival completed the classic lineup, setting the stage for the band's ascent. Together, they crafted a sound that was heavier, faster, and more intense than what most people had heard before. It was, arguably, a game-changing combination.

Albums like "British Steel," "Screaming for Vengeance," and "Painkiller" became essential listening for metal fans worldwide. Halford's operatic vocals, combined with the twin guitar attack, created a truly distinctive style. They weren't just making music; they were, in a way, forging a new path for an entire genre. Their impact, to be honest, cannot be overstated.

The band's live shows were also legendary, featuring Halford's iconic entrance on a Harley-Davidson motorcycle. This imagery, along with the leather and studs, became synonymous with heavy metal. It was, pretty much, the ultimate visual representation of their sound. That commitment to the whole experience really resonated with people.

Inside the Rob Halford Book: Confess

The Rob Halford book, titled "Confess," offers a remarkably open and detailed account of his life. Co-written with Ian Gittins, it provides an intimate look at the man behind the microphone. It's not just a memoir; it's a very candid conversation with a true icon. You get to hear his voice, so to speak, on every page.

What to Expect from the Memoir

Readers can expect a chronological journey through Halford's life, from his childhood in working-class England to his global superstardom. The book covers his early musical endeavors, the formation of Judas Priest, and the band's rise to fame. It also delves into the periods when he stepped away from the band and explored other projects. There's a lot of ground covered, which is nice.

You'll find plenty of anecdotes about life on the road, the creative process behind classic songs, and interactions with other music legends. It's a rich tapestry of experiences, offering a genuine insider's perspective on the heavy metal scene. It's, basically, a front-row seat to history.

Beyond the music, the book explores Halford's personal life with a level of honesty that is truly commendable. It tackles his struggles with addiction and his journey of self-discovery as a gay man in the often-conservative world of heavy metal. This personal openness is, honestly, one of the book's greatest strengths. It makes it very human.

Is the Rob Halford book "Confess" an autobiography?

Yes, "Confess" is indeed Rob Halford's autobiography. It's his personal account of his life, career, and experiences, written in collaboration with Ian Gittins. It covers his journey from childhood through his decades in music. It's a very direct and personal narrative, so.

What are some of the main topics covered in the Rob Halford book?

The book covers a wide range of topics, including his early life, the formation and rise of Judas Priest, his struggles with addiction, and his journey of coming out as gay. It also includes many behind-the-scenes stories from the music industry and his personal relationships. It's quite comprehensive, really. You get a lot of detail.
